What is GenPink?04.20.07

GenPink is short for Generation Pink. GenPink will be the ramblings and insights of living life as a twenty something working woman.

Let’s just start with how this idea came to me. I am an idea person. Quite frequently I find myself coming up with new ideas about this or that. Most of the time I will share my fabulous idea with a friend. Usually that idea never comes to fruition because it is soon replaced by a bigger and better idea. Well the idea for GenPink came to me a few days ago and for some reason this one stuck (at least for now).

The idea manifested from my love of technology and my interest in the vast knowledge of the web. I am forever finding some new site that I absolutely love. Some of those sites I become interested in and don’t share with my friends (most of my friends are not as nerdy as me). There is the occasional site that I find that I think it just too great to pass up and I take a few moments to write up a little blurb (hey guys I found this fun site) then I send it out mass email to my friends. For some reason rarely are they as excited as me.

Instead of barraging my friends with all my great findings of fun little sites here and there I decided to create a blog. This will accomplish a few things.

  1. I meet new people with similar interests
  2. All of my random findings will be stored in once place
  3. I can stop pestering me friends (probably not though)

So lets start small. Here is a list of my favorite fun websites that I believe make my life easier.

  1. del.icio.us - This is a great way to save your favorite websites all in one place. You can use tags to keep everything organized. I am constantly changing from 3 different computers and I love that no matter where I am I can have access to my favorites. I am so diverse that the amount of bookmarks and categories (tags) I have is a bit ridiculous. Another fun thing is you can network with people and send them a link that you think they might be interested in.
  2. evite - Everyone who knows me knows I am in love with evite. I’m not sure what there is to say about evite other than you should register and create your address book with groups so that sending invitations is speedy.
  3. Cool Site of the Day - The title pretty much says it all. I am on their email list, so every day I get some random "cool" site emailed to me. Some of them are better than others.
  4. 9rules - I’m not really sure how to describe this site so here is their about us - "9rules is a place where members and readers can connect, build relationships, gain exposure, learn new things, and have fun."
